Allegion’s Registered Senior Notes Offering

July 06, 2022

Cravath represented the underwriters in connection with the $600 million registered senior notes offering of Allegion US Holding Company Inc., a leading global provider of security products and solutions. The transaction closed on June 22, 2022.

The Cravath team included partner Michael E. Mariani and associates Janice T. P. Martindale and Katharine E. Waldman on capital markets matters; associates Carlos Nicholas Obando and Sonia Katharani-Khan on tax matters; senior attorney Annmarie M. Terraciano on environmental matters; and associate Cortez Johnson on executive compensation and benefits matters. Summer associate Helen Catherine Darby also worked on capital markets matters.
